BHP - Price-sensitive ASX Announcement
Full Release
Key Points
- BHP reported production and sales across several key segments including copper, silver, uranium, and gold.
- The operational review covers the period ending 30 June 2025.
- Copper production in South Australia faced a slight decline, with a 4% decrease in payable metal in concentrate.
- Olympic Dam experienced a reduction in mined material and ore milled by 9% and 3% respectively.
- Escondida in Chile saw improvements in copper production, with a notable 22% increase in payable copper.
- Antamina in Peru experienced a reduction in mined material by 13% and a decrease in payable copper by 17%.
- Refined silver and gold production at Olympic Dam saw a reduction, with refined gold dropping by 9%.
- Iron ore production from Western Australia Iron Ore (WAIO) remained stable with a slight 1% increase.
- Total copper production was strong, with Escondida contributing a significant share despite some declines in other areas.

ALX - Price-sensitive ASX Announcement
Full Release
Key Points
- Virginia Supreme Court affirmed SCC's decision denying TRIP II's toll rate application.
- TRIP II's federal case will proceed, alleging constitutional violations.
- TRIP II plans to submit a new rate application.
